Job Description

Project Manager - Life Sciences

A leading provider of innovative solutions and services in the life sciences industry is seeking a skilled Project Manager to join their team. This organization partners with some of the most recognizable brands in the sector, helping to drive growth, innovation, and impactful healthcare solutions. The role offers the opportunity to work alongside a team of over 500 experts dedicated to improving lives through science and technology.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ead project management activities within the life sciences industry, ensuring alignment with client expectations.
  • Oversee lifecycle management for quality applications and support protocol development and execution.
  • Manage project scope, budget, timelines, and change orders.
  • Plan and execute medium to large-scale projects, iterating on new ideas to maximize return on investment.
  • Develop and maintain detailed project schedules and work plans.
  • Serve as the primary liaison between internal teams and clients, addressing scope, timeline, and budget changes.
  • Provide clear and frequent project updates to stakeholders.
  • Facilitate problem-solving meetings using methodologies such as FMEA and root cause analysis.
  • Coordinate with vendors to ensure timely, budget-conscious delivery of materials and equipment.
  • Collaborate with business partners to define project teams and activities.
  • Manage cross-functional resources and dependencies to ensure project success.
  • Monitor and control project schedules, financials, and deliverables.
  • Prepare and present project status reports to senior leadership.
  • Maintain comprehensive project documentation and conduct post-implementation reviews.
  • Track project KPIs and outcomes.

Qualifications:

  • Must be willing to work onsite in Portland, ME.
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, business, or a related field.
  • 7+ years of industry experience.
  • PMP certification preferred.
  • Strong problem-solving and creative thinking skills.
  • Proficiency with project management tools and methodologies.
  • Demonstrated success managing projects through the full lifecycle.
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Experience in pharmaceutical project management and vendor coordination.
  • Strong risk management, team leadership, and analytical capabilities.
  • Familiarity with tools such as Word, Excel, and MS Project.

Additional Information:

  • Salary range (US): $85,000 - $128,960 USD, depending on experience, location, and market factors.
